Open Source Projects
Explore open source hardware projects other folks uploaded and share your own. With CADLAB.io hardware version control it is way easier to work on hardware design projects together.
CADLAB demo project with interactive guide.
A PCB-based system that monitors main and backup power sources, ensuring timely alerts during outages or low backup levels.
A **programmable power supply** is an electronic device that provides controlled and adjustable electrical power to a circuit or device. Unlike fixed power supplies, it allows users to set voltage, current, and sometimes power limits through software, digital interfaces, or manual controls. These power supplies are commonly used in testing, automation, and research applications where precise and repeatable power control is required. They often feature remote programmability via USB, Ethernet, or GPIB interfaces, making them ideal for integration into automated test setups.
This ESP32 smartwatch PCB is a compact, wearable design featuring Wi-Fi, Bluetooth, an OLED/TFT display, and essential sensors like an accelerometer and heart rate monitor. It includes Li-Po battery management, optimized power efficiency, and a sleek layout for smart wearable applications.
RFID-based toll collection systems use Radio Frequency Identification to automate vehicle toll payments. Each vehicle is equipped with an RFID tag containing user and payment information. As the vehicle passes through the toll gate, an RFID reader scans the tag and deducts the toll fee. This system reduces congestion, minimizes human error, and speeds up toll transactions.
A Smart Bicycle Lighting System enhances cyclist safety with automatic headlights and taillights that adjust based on ambient light. It includes a brake light function that activates during deceleration and turn signals for better road communication. Some versions feature wireless control via Bluetooth, allowing customization through a smartphone app. Designed using KiCad, it integrates microcontrollers, sensors, and power management for efficient and reliable performance.
A Solar Tracking System is designed to maximize solar energy absorption by adjusting the position of solar panels based on sunlight direction. This project uses a custom PCB integrating sensors, a microcontroller, motor drivers, and power circuits to automate the tracking process.